在国内高校或者研究所就读的绝大多数工科研究生都需要在毕业之前发表一篇或者多篇英文论文。英文论文一般包括Tittle、Abstract、Keywords、Introduction、Experimental section、Results and discussion和Conclusion这几个部分。其中Introduction是一篇论文中必不可少重要组成部分,一般会放在一篇论文中正文内容的最前面,仅次于Abstract和Keywords之后。Abstract和Keywords的重要性大家应该都知道,紧接其后的Introduction重要性也可想而知。我们必须通过Introduction来让读者明白这个篇论文工作的研究背景、研究现状、目前存在的问题、这篇工作将要解决什么问题、通过什么方法去解决问题和最终达到的效果。Introduction不是简单的抄袭和模仿,而是要完全围绕这篇论文的创新点去展开讲述,要能让读者通过阅读这一部分就能明白你研究工作的真正意义。

也可采用三部分分段介绍的模式,第一部分先交代研究背景和现状;第二部分写在你所研究领域目前存在的问题和你将要解决的问题;第三部分再写你采用了什么方法和手段解决这个问题并达到了什么样的效果。

怎么写好英文论文的Introduction部分

以此篇文章为例,第一部分主要会写相关领域的一些大的背景及具体的现状:引出大的背景,概述该研究领域被研究的原因和实际意义,然后引出本文小背景,具体讲一些你所研究小领域的研究意义、目的以及目前存在的问题。

大背景Heat-resistant steel 53Cr21Mn9Ni4N (21-4N steel) has been widely used for engine exhaust valves because it has excellent strength and toughness at high temperatures, as well as strong corrosion resistance in extreme working environments. In the past decades, 21-4N steel has attracted the attentions of scientists and engineers.

小背景Carbide is one of the most important microstructural features of 21-4N steel. Mechanical properties and behaviours of 21-4N steels at high temperatures strongly depend on the type, shape, size, amount and distribution of carbides. Carbide is formed in the solidification process and is composed by three chemical elements: Cr, Fe and Mn in 21-4N steel. Furthermore, the dissolution of carbides in solution treatment enriches the matrix with alloying elements, which results in an exceptional heat resistance and the capability of secondary hardening by aging precipitates. Undissolved carbides after aging treatment remain in 21-4N steels which lead to the wear resistance. However, mechanical properties will be affected a lot, if the size of them is too large or they have inhomogeneous distribution .

需要注意的是:

(1)研究背景这段的逻辑关系一定要层层递进,先说大的背景,然后引出小的背景。自然切入主题,不要生搬硬套,不要直接说出来显得很突兀。

(2)Introduction部分一定要逻辑清楚,直白描述,不用过度引申说一些和题目不相关的事情,造成引言部分过于冗长,有凑字数的嫌疑。即使后面的实验内容很精彩,引言内容不行也不是一篇合格的文章。

第二部分主要会写一些从小背景过渡到研究相关的引用,其中包括存在的问题及已经报道过的解决方法,对该领域研究问题相关的参考文献的陈列。

需要注意的是!这块一定不是文献的堆砌,而是综述相关研究进展。否则外审可能会说“Introduction部分的文献部分和题目不相关,更多的是文献的堆积。”之类的。

Therefore, it is necessary to control size, shape and distribution of carbides of as-cast and hot-rolled steel, specially the size. A minor amount of Mg in the stainless steels and superalloys significantly refines the carbides in the literature. For example, Gong et al. added Mg(0.01– 0.015wt-%) to the steel Cr14Mo4 and found that a trace amount of Mg can refine and disperse carbides by presenting in the matrix and grain boundary. Ge et al. studied the effects of segregation of Mg (0.024–0.1wt-%,) on high carbon (18wt-% Cr) as-cast steel and found that a minor amount of Mg refines the primary carbide (Cr0.51Fe0.49)7C3, and improves significantly impact toughness of the alloy. Li et al. reported that a trace amount of Mg(0.001wt-%) strengthens carbide segregation and reduces their size in die steel H13. Bor et al. chosen Mar-M247 to study the influence of Mg(0.002–0.008wt-%) microaddition on carbide characteristics and concluded that a trace amount of Mg can change carbide morphology and refine the size of carbides significantly.

这里还需要注意一下的是:准确引用参考文献。要重视参考文献的引用,不要随意引用,不要过量引用,也不要缺引和漏引。

参考文献一般引用高水平,有代表性的学术文献,引用原始文献,引用最新发表的重要文献,少引或者不引综述性的文章,特别是避免引用很长的综述(因为读者不会去看),不要在不相关的地方自引。

这里的每篇文章尽量用一句话进行简单的概括,与题目不相关的研究结果可以省略不写,尽可能做到句句点题。

第三部分主要概括描述你这篇论文工作中采用策略、方法及结果,阐明你的研究工作的重点和优势。

其中要写明大部分人的研究方法是什么,有什么样的缺点,而你在这方面的研究中采用的新手段和理念(你的亮点)。最后,总结你的工作取得什么样的成就,存在着什么样的师实际意义。

加粗的为套路句式,可以参考。

As aforementioned, many studies investigated the effect of Mg on carbide particle size and on mechanical properties of stainless steels or superalloys. However, few studies have been carried out to study the effect of morphology changes on the transformation of carbides. Therefore, this study concentrates on morphology changes of carbides and the effect of Mg on the M7C3→M23C6 transformation in the 21-4N steel. First of all, this paper provides theoretical thermodynamical calculation of the 21-4N steel with different contents of Mg on the M7C3→M23C6 transformation. Then, three contents of Mg were added into the liquid steel, the liquid steel casted into ingots (as-cast sample) and the ingots through hot-rolling changed into bars (hot-rolling sample). Finally, the microstructure of 21-4N steel including as-cast and hot-rolling samples is analysed. Results in this study are used to explore the effect of Mg on carbide characteristics and control the carbide particle size in stainless steel.

以下是句型汇总↓↓↓

1. 大背景小背景:

For decades, one of the most popular ideas in ... literature is the idea that ...Recent theoretical developments have revealed that ...

Most of the theories of ... are however focused on explaining ...

2. 发现问题:

There is a further problem with ...

Unfortunately, this approach results in problems related to ...

These constraints make the problem difficult to ...

Most of the research in ... field is aimed at solving ...

3. 文献综述

For example, Gong et al. .... Ge et al. studied the effects of ....

4. 研究意义 :

ln comparison with other techniques, this method has the advantage of ...

The benefit of using the ... is expected to ...

引言部分宁短勿长,刚开始写论文的同学最好把引言部分写得简洁精练,运用简单句通过三部分递进的模式。

好的论文一定要表述清晰明了,段落层层递进,就像一篇小说的前情概要一样,让读者对你的研究领域有一个总览全局的了解,那么才能能够对你论文当中具体研究内容感兴趣并做到充分理解。
